Table 1 Frequency, sensitivity and specificity of symptoms for clinical malaria (symptomatic Plasmodium falciparum parasitaemia) in children <5 years of age

From: Sensitivity of fever for diagnosis of clinical malaria in a Kenyan area of unstable, low malaria transmission

Symptoms

Pf pos,an (%)

Pf neg,bn (%)

P value

Sensitivity (%)

Specificity (%)

Fever

32 (89)

506 (85)

0. 49

88. 9

15. 4

Appetite loss

25 (64)

323 (54)

0. 07

69. 4

46

Headache

19 (53)

191 (32)

0. 01

52. 8

68. 1

Vomiting

11 (31)

237 (40)

0. 28

30. 6

60. 4

Chills

10 (28)

56 (9)

<0. 001

27. 8

90. 6

Malaise

7 (19)

53 (9)

0. 04

19. 4

91. 1

Diarrhea

5 (14)

121 (20)

0. 35

13. 9

79. 8

Nausea

3 (8)

30 (5)

0. 38

8. 3

95

Joint pains

1 (3)

12 (2)

0. 75

2. 8

98

Jaundice

0 (0)

7 (1)

0. 51

0

98. 8

Backache

0 (0)

8 (1)

0. 49

0

98. 7

  1. Abbreviations: Pf P. falciparum, pos positive, neg negative.
  2. aTotal N for Pf pos, N = 36.
  3. bTotal N for Pf neg, N = 598.
